Tata Consultancy Services (TCS), Accenture, and Infosys have claimed the top three spots on LinkedIn’s 2025 Top Companies list for India, as highlighted in a recent report by the professional networking giant. This annual ranking showcases 25 major companies that excel in providing their employees with robust career advancement opportunities, determined by user interactions on LinkedIn.
Tech Sector Dominance in Job Opportunities
Cognizant secured a position in the top five, underscoring the resilience of the Computer, IT, and Software sectors within India’s job market. These industry leaders are actively seeking candidates with essential skills in development tools, data storage solutions, and enterprise software. This trend is particularly evident in tech hubs such as Bengaluru, Hyderabad, and Chennai.
- The top companies prioritize hiring for:
- Development tools
- Data storage technologies
- Enterprise software expertise
Methodology Behind the Rankings
The rankings are derived from a range of factors, including opportunities for advancement, skill enhancement, external job prospects, and employee loyalty. This comprehensive methodology emphasizes how these companies foster environments that promote long-term career growth.
Nirajita Banerjee, a LinkedIn Career Expert and Senior Managing Editor for India, stated, “This year’s insights reveal that organizations are hiring not just for their current needs, but also for their future aspirations. Nineteen of the top 25 companies hail from technology, finance, and enterprise software sectors, searching for skilled professionals who can collaborate across teams, think critically, adapt swiftly, and evolve alongside the company.”
New Entrants and Market Shifts
The 2025 list reveals significant changes in the Indian employment landscape, with 12 out of the 25 companies being first-time entrants. Fidelity Investments made a notable debut at number four, followed by ServiceNow at 17 and Stripe at 21.
The financial services sector has a strong showing, with seven firms represented, including JPMorgan Chase at 7, Wells Fargo at 15, and American Express at 25. These organizations are looking to fill roles such as:
- Business operations analyst
- Fraud analyst
- Financial analyst
Skills in capital markets, investment banking, and commercial banking are particularly in demand.
Global Tech Giants Hiring in India
International technology companies are also bolstering their recruitment efforts in India. Amazon ranks at 8, Alphabet at 9, and Salesforce at 12, all actively seeking candidates for positions like software engineer, data analyst, and account manager. Key skills in demand at these firms include:
- Artificial intelligence
- AI engineering
- Mobile application development
Additionally, companies such as Synopsys Inc (13), Continental (14), and RTX (20) are investing in teams focused on design engineering, test engineering, and quality assurance. The required skills for these roles include:
- Computer hardware
- Signal processing
- Electronic control systems
Importance of Skills in Job Applications
As skill requirements remain a focal point in hiring practices, Banerjee encourages job seekers to emphasize both their technical and non-technical skills on their professional profiles. She noted, “With AI reshaping the employment landscape, leaders and recruiters are particularly focused on finding the right blend of skills.”
